Cattany <br />Division Director <br />Natural Resource Trustee <br />vINADEOUATE ANNUAL FEE/ANNUAL REPORT PACKET <br />On May 3Q 2006, the Division of Minerals and Geology received your Annual Fee/Annual Report Packet <br />("Packet") for Permit No. M-1985-072, Taramarcaz Pit. However according to Division records, the Packet is <br />inadequate `-~-' <br />Annual Fee: Inadequate Anuual Report: Adequate <br />If the annual fee is inadequate please send the remaining balance. If they have not been received, please remit <br />$281.00. <br />If the annual report is inadequate or has not been received, please submit either a written report or an <br />adequately labeled map, as required by Rule 1.15. Enclosed is an annual report form with reporting <br />instructions on the back. The Anuual Report and Fee requirement is not met until we have received the <br />following components: fee, reaort, and associated map (all are required regardless of the level of <br />disturbance or absence of disturbance during the previous year). <br />FAILURE TO SUBMIT AN ADEQUATE PACKET MAY RESULT IN ENFORCEMENT ACTION <br />WITH ASSOCIATED CIVIL PENALTIES. The Division must receive the complete Packet no later than <br />5 p.m. on July 31, 2006 (if this date falls on a weekend or state recognized holiday your Packet will be due on the <br />next regulaz business day), or a Notice of Violation, Cease and Desist Order from ALL mining related activifies, <br />Civil Penalties equal to the amount of the annual fee(s) due, and a Notice of Formal Public Hearing before the <br />Mined Land Reclamation Board for consideration of POSSIBLE PERMIT REVOCATION AND FINANCIAL <br />WARRANTY FORFETI'[JRE will be issued for this account. <br />Thank you for you cooperation with this matter.
